Build ECommerce Shopping Cart by React and Redux

Updated: Jul 16, 2021



The programming language and functionality in this project is given in below

  • Design Shopping Cart Using HTML and CSS

  • Implement React Components For Product List, Filter, Cart

  • Managing Component State using Redux, React-Redux and - Redux-Thunk

  • Creating Animations Using React-Reveal and Add Routes using React-Routers

  • Build Backend using Node, Express, MongoDB and Mongoose

  • Publish Project on the Heroku and MongoDB Atlas


How to start the project

  • Type npm start(first server start on localhost:3000)

  • after that type npm run server(second server start on loclhost:6000)

  • Before start second server set api in Postman Type:http://localhost:6000/api/products in (GET) and (POST) http://localhost:6000/api/products

  • Press ctr+c disconnect the server

Checkout Form

  1. Set Active Task Management Spreadsheet

  2. Create branch checkout-form

  3. Cart.js

  4. Make cart items persistent

  5. Use LocalStorage on App constructor to load cart items (JSON.parse)

  6. Use LocalStorage on addToCart to save cart items (JSON.stringify)

  7. Handle Click on Proceed

  8. Update showCheckout state to true on click

  9. Conditional rendering Checkout Form

  10. Get Email, Name and Address required input

  11. Define handleInput function

  12. Add Checkout Button

  13. Handle onSubmit Form Event by this.createOrder

  14. Create order object and pass to parent to handle it

  15. Commit and Publish changes

  16. Pull request, merge, change to master

  17. Task Management Spreadsheet set it done

Add Redux

  1. what is redux (diagram)

  2. update task on spreadsheet

  3. create branch add-redux-products

  4. npm install redux react-redux redux-thunk

  5. create types

  6. types.js

  7. define FETCH_PRODUCTS

  8. actions/productActions.js

  9. declare fetchProducts

  10. create reducers

  11. reducers/productReducers.js

  12. define case FETCH_PRODUCTS

  13. create store

  14. store.js

  15. import redux

  16. set initial state

  17. define initialState

  18. create store

  19. import productReducers

  20. combine reducers

  21. Use store

  22. App.js

  23. import store

  24. wrap all in Provider

  25. connect products

  26. components/Products.js

  27. connect to store

  28. i mport fetchProducts

  29. fetch products on did mount

  30. package.json

  31. set proxy to http://198.168.0.14:6000

  32. npm run server

  33. check products list

  34. commit and publish

  35. send pull request and merge

  36. update spreadsheet
